Fans of The Hunchback of Notre Dame may want to get their hands on this limited edition Disney Designer Collection Dance Series doll. It features Esmeralda in an opulent gown holding her tambourine.
We saw this doll at Off the Page at Disney California Adventure; however, it is also available online at the Disney Store.
Disney Designer Collection Esmeralda Limited Edition 3660 Doll – $129.99

At 12″ tall, this Esmeralda doll is dressed in a layered satin and sheer organza gown in reds and purples. Throughout the gown are gold embroidered filigree details that complement the doll’s other gold accessories, like the tiara. The tambourine in Esemeralda’s hand is adorned with satin ribbons.

Because this is a limited edition doll, it comes with a certificate of verification. It also comes with a display stand. Or, if guests prefer to keep the doll in its box, the background behind Esmeralda shows a festive Paris.
Other limited edition dolls in this collection include Mulan, Aurora, Giselle, Tinker Bell, and Belle. It appears all but Giselle are currently available online.
